Mouth Breathing Syndrome: What is it?

If you habitually breathe through your mouth, you could suffer from Mouth Breathing Syndrome, a practice that has various consequences for your health.

This disorder It usually starts at an early age And people who suffer from it experience it in different ways. While some people are used to breathing through their mouths only during sleep, others combine nasal and mouth breathing throughout the day.

And, in the most extreme cases, there are also people who breathe almost exclusively through their mouths.

What are the health effects of breathing through your mouth?

Although this practice may seem harmless, the truth is that habitually breathing through the mouth has consequences for overall well-being.

The The nose acts as a filter for the air we breathe., something that does not happen when air enters directly through the mouth.

Furthermore, there are other consequences of this practice: on the one hand, it produces postural changes occur and throat problems worsen. -like tonsillitis-, in addition to to experience allergies more intensely

The Sleep quality is also affected If you breathe through your mouth. This causes problems with insomnia and fatigue, as well as variations in mood.

The circulatory and respiratory systems are also compromised, since breathing through the mouth means less oxygen reaches the brain.

If you breathe through your mouth, you are harming the health of your teeth.

Regarding oral health, breathing through your mouth can also cause various problems. It's common for people who do this to experience... muscle problems in the mouth due to the forced position.

Also, the following are common disorders of the jaws, as well as suffer alterations in the palate and dental occlusion problems.

On the other hand, breathing through the mouth makes it easier to xerostomia, That is, dry mouth. Saliva is essential when... keep your mouth clean, as it acts against the bacteria that reside in the oral cavity.

Dry mouth greatly contributes to the development of oral diseases such as cavities or other oral diseases.
